One square, not one room
When something goes badly wrong on a broadloom carpet, in a spot the size of a dinner plate, the honest options are living with it, patching it visibly, or replacing the room. That is a hard conversation and it is one of the reasons people abandon soft flooring in the rooms where accidents actually happen.
Carpet tile removes the problem entirely. The damaged square lifts out and a new one drops in. If you keep a box of spares from the same run when the floor is installed, and we would always recommend that, a repair is a five minute job with no colour mismatch and no visible patch. It is the single most useful property this material has.
Where that matters most
Basements, because a slab is unpredictable and because if water ever does appear you can lift the affected area rather than lose the floor. Playrooms, because the things that get spilled in them are the things that stain permanently. Home gyms, because dropped weights damage a specific spot rather than a general area. Home offices with a rolling chair, because that chair wears one exact track.
In our basement guide this is why carpet tile keeps appearing in the recommendations. A below-grade room wants comfort and warmth underfoot, which argues for something soft, but also wants to survive whatever a slab eventually does, which argues for something you can lift. Carpet tile is the only material that answers both.
It stopped looking like an office floor
The reasonable objection to carpet tile is that it reads as commercial, and for a long time that was fair. Modern residential-appropriate carpet tile comes in patterns, textures and pile styles that are a very long way from a flat grey square, and many can be laid in different orientations to produce a subtle pattern or laid uniformly to read as one continuous surface.

How it goes down
Carpet tile is typically installed with a releasable adhesive rather than being permanently bonded, which is what allows individual squares to be lifted later without damaging their neighbours. Many products carry their cushioning on the back of the tile itself, so a separate pad is often unnecessary, which keeps the finished height low and helps in a basement where headroom is finite.
The floor underneath still has to be sound and reasonably flat. On a slab we look at what moisture is coming up through the concrete before recommending anything, because that assessment governs the whole decision below grade. When broadloom is still the better answer
In a main bedroom, ordinary broadloom carpet is usually the nicer floor. It can be softer underfoot, the choice is wider, and a bedroom is not a room where repairability is a pressing concern. On stairs, broadloom wrapped properly over the nosing is the right approach and we would not put tile there.
Carpet tile earns its place in the rooms where things happen: below grade, where children play, where weights land, where a chair rolls.
